Concentration
Eau de Parfum
Standard modern strength, roughly 15 to 20 percent aromatic oils. All-day wear with moderate projection. The default for most contemporary designer and niche releases.

1996 Inez & Vinoodh by Byredo is often described as a complex and intriguing fragrance. Users note its blend of leather and spices, with a fresh opening from juniper berries and black pepper, leading into a heart of soft leather and floral notes like violet. The base is rich with patchouli and vanilla, giving it a warm, slightly animalic finish. While many enthusiasts appreciate its unique character and depth, some casual wearers find it too challenging or polarizing for everyday use. It is frequently recommended for cooler weather and evening occasions due to its bold nature.
